IHG Hotels & Resorts, renowned British multinational company headquartered in Windsor, Berkshire, England, UK, group that manages, operates and franchises hotels, resorts and vacation properties under several brands across the world returns will launch a new global branded luxury hotel in the stunning Barossa Valley in South Australia.
The British group will introduce its luxury hotel brand, InterContinental Hotels & Resorts to one of Australia's most celebrated wine regions, the Barossa Valley, located 60 kilometres northeast od Adelaide city centre, an area encompasses towns such as Angaston, Nuriootpa and Tanunda, a land boasts an array of high – profile wineries offering tours and cellar - door tastings with the signing of InterContinental Barossa Resort & Spa.
The Barossa, with its rich history and renowned natural beauty highlighted by picturesque hills in a stunning valley formed by the North Para River, crossed by the spectacular "Barossa Valley Way", is one of Australia's most popular tourist destinations and the InteContinental Barosa Resort & Spa's prime location in the heart of this beautiful territory will be the perfect luxury tetreat for visitors looking to immerse themselves in the region's wineries and vineyards.
The hotel will be set amid the rolling hills and lush vineyards of the Barossa is scheduled to open in 2028, an operation managed by IHG Hotels & Resorts in partnership with Strategic Alliance.
The property will feature 150 rooms with beautiful views of the vineyards and landscape, a 130 - seat signature restaurant, lounge bar, outdoor garden terrace and the signature Club InterContinental.
Other amenities will include a day spa, fitness centre, a pool, conference and meeting spaces and the resort will also offer scenic walking trails and easy access to a variety of outdoor activities in the region.
